Description[Arg8]-Vasotocin (TFA) is a nonmammalian vertebrate neurohypophyseal peptide.(In Vitro):[Arg8]-Vasotocin occurs throughout the vertebrate phyla, being present in primitive fish, the cyclostomes, and remaining unchanged in vertebrates up to and including birds. [Arg8]-Vasotocin excites neurones in the dorsal vagal complex in vitro.
